 Replying to [comment:4 was]:
 > Now Rob (say) has to review this new patch.

 Yes, I've got it.  Looks good and ''nearly'' optimal.  Nothing much to add
 in the way of performance.

 Comments:

 Line 127 - typo in comments  "slowedue"

 Line 447 - return statement with zero vector should now be dead code - at
 least we want it to be.  Commenting-it out and running tests confirms.
 The comment preceding needs adjustment.

 Line 665 - is the whole discussion about "or" now moot with the super-fast
 ``is_Ring()`` defined earlier?

 Line 670 - error message: can we say  "first argument must be a ring"
 rather than "arg0 must be a ring"?

 Reactions?  I can make a follow-up patch for you to review, or vice-versa?
